Java e Orientação a Objetos: Curso de Formação Completa com a Alura

Essa linguagem é geralmente usada em uma variedade de aplicações, incluindo desenvolvimento web, ciência de dados, inteligência artificial, aprendizado de máquina e automação. A linguagem de programação é usada para controlar o comportamento das máquinas, particularmente os computadores. As linguagens de programação permitem que os programadores comuniquem-se com as máquinas de uma forma que seja mais fácil de entender e manipular do que a linguagem nativa. Ela envolve a compreensão de como usar estruturas de controle como loops, condicionais, funções, entre outras, para manipular dados e criar algoritmos.

Entenda a história das linguagens de programação!

Ele aborda os conceitos básicos e avançados do TypeScript e inclui projetos com TypeScript, React e Express. Com mais de 3300 alunos, este curso tem uma classificação de 4,7 estrelas. Stack Overflow Jobs é uma plataforma de busca de empregos que faz parte do Stack Overflow, uma comunidade online popular para desenvolvedores. Ele lista vagas de emprego que vão desde programação até ciência de dados.

Linguagem C: o que é e quais os principais fundamentos!

o'que e linguagem de programação

As linhas de código são escritas como sentenças que devem obedecer regras e fatos dentro de uma determinada lógica estabelecida. Uma função é uma expressão matemática que a gente pode reutilizar várias vezes em distintos contextos. Logo, o foco dessa programação, quando pura, é criar https://piauinoticias.com/educa%C3%A7%C3%A3o/114012-trazendo-o-futuro-para-o-presente-explorando-a-ci%C3%AAncia-de-dados-e-machine-learning.html um código mais enxuto que contém somente funções matemáticas que são executadas e que executam umas às outras. Vamos conhecer os 6 principais e mais importantes paradigmas de programação. As variáveis são conceitos iniciais que aparecem sempre nas linguagens de programação.

Linguagens de alto nível

As condições permitem que o algoritmo tome decisões a partir de critérios estabelecidos. Ele executará diversos blocos de código considerando diferentes situações possíveis. Por exemplo, um programa de notas pode estabelecer que o critério para a aprovação é obter um resultado a partir de 70. As variáveis e constantes também são conceitos cruciais de programação básica, pois através destes elementos pode-se definir a natureza da organização e manipulação dos dados de um algoritmo. No geral, os dados estruturados representam um conjunto de dados primitivos que são conectados. Por exemplo, para representar um usuário do produto, pode ser útil juntar o nome, a idade e o e-mail dele em uma estrutura única.

  • Algumas startups conhecidas utilizam TypeScript nas suas aplicações web, como Slack, Asana, Canva e Typeform.
  • Este curso de Webpack oferece 76 aulas em 7 horas, abrangendo o Webpack, uma ferramenta de compilação de módulos estáticos para aplicações JavaScript modernas.
  • Com ela você pode programar e implementar elementos complexos, assim como barras de pesquisa, por exemplo.
  • Qualquer pessoa que deseja seguir nessa área deve ter conhecimento nessas três ferramentas.
  • Lembre-se, antes de se frustrar, que a aprendizagem é um processo que requer paciência.

Vantagens e desvantagens das linguagens de programação

Esse passo a passo que possibilita que você chegue ao seu objetivo pode ser considerado um algoritmo. Na área de programação, os algoritmos podem ser construídos em diversas linguagens de programação, dependendo dos objetivos propostos. Em programação, o algoritmo é a sequência lógica de comandos necessários para atingir o objetivo do sistema. Por meio das instruções dadas ao algoritmo, o computador consegue executar estes comandos e traduzi-los em respostas esperadas.

Os hackers, assim como os desenvolvedores no meio corporativo, usam uma variedade de linguagens de programação. As linguagens são mais populares na comunidade hacker devido à sua flexibilidade, acessibilidade e poder, é o Python, por causa de sua fácil legibilidade e extensa biblioteca padrão. HTML, que significa Linguagem de Marcação de Hipertexto (HyperText Markup Language), é a linguagem padrão para a criação de páginas e aplicativos da web. HTML não é uma linguagem de programação, mas sim uma linguagem de marcação. R é uma linguagem de programação e um software de ambiente para estatísticas e gráficos. Criada em 1993 por Ross Ihaka e Robert Gentleman, R é amplamente utilizada para análise estatística, visualização de dados e relatórios.

Cada uma delas é composta por termos e comandos específicos que são usados para criar coisas como páginas da web, aplicativos e, basicamente, qualquer tipo de software. A Linguagem Ruby foi criada em 1995 por Yukihiro Matsumoto, com a intenção de ser uma linguagem de script. É uma linguagem interpretada multiparadigma de tipagem dinâmica e forte, suportando programação funcional, imperativa, Trazendo o futuro para o presente: explorando a ciência de dados e machine learning reflexiva, orientada a objetos. A Linguagem C# (lê-se C Sharp) foi lançada no início dos anos 2000 pela Microsoft. É uma linguagem de programação de alto nível e é parte do framework .NET (dot NET). É uma linguagem de fácil entendimento quando usada para aplicações básicas, uma vez que sua sintaxe se assemelha muito com a língua inglesa, então é indicada para iniciantes.

  • Uma das maiores vantagens de saber linguagem de programação é a capacidade de resolver problemas de maneira mais eficiente.
  • Por ter uma sintaxe simples e de fácil entendimento, o PHP é recomendado para iniciantes.
  • Por isso, existem diferentes níveis de linguagem que aproximam nossa comunicação com o modo de interpretar de um computador.